Measure the area (length x width) and decide the required depth, then use a material calculator to convert cubic feet to tons. Plan on 5-10% extra for compaction, grading, and waste, and remember regional densities vary so tonnage may differ. Materials that drain well and resist frost heave perform best in freeze-thaw climates like Leavittsburg. Using well-graded aggregates with a solid compacted base and ensuring surface and sub-surface drainage reduces movement and potholes. Avoid fine, clay-rich soils for load-bearing layers and consult local suppliers for mixes sourced to suit West Ohio conditions. Proper site prep and drainage are often more important than the final surface material alone.
Late spring through early fall is generally the easiest time for deliveries and installations in Leavittsburg, when ground is not frozen and weather is more predictable. Spring thaw can limit site access and winter deliveries are often restricted by frozen ground or road rules. Many local suppliers and contracted haulers will deliver to rural addresses near Leavittsburg, but delivery depends on road access, weight limits, and turnaround space for dump trucks. Provide clear delivery notes at checkout (driveway width, overhead wires, preferred drop location) so drivers and dispatchers can confirm feasibility. Tailgate spreading may be possible but is at the driver’s discretion and not guaranteed. If access is limited, ask about offloading options or smaller truck deliveries.

Materials with larger, angular particles and a well-graded mix tend to allow faster drainage and resist clogging in local soils. Designing the project with appropriate slope, sub-base preparation, and possibly a geotextile underlayer helps manage water across the site. Local suppliers can recommend specific mixes based on your soil test or on-site conditions. Good drainage comes from both material choice and proper installation, so plan both together.

Labor and installation costs vary widely depending on project complexity, site prep required, equipment needed, and local contractor rates. Expect additional costs for excavation, grading, compaction, and edge restraints beyond material costs, and get written estimates from local contractors for accurate budgeting. Homeowners doing DIY projects can save on labor but should account for time, rental equipment, and possible rework.
